Output bf64aa51d56632183fc4c495a5b418856469a0eb373332e720d3ef2ec74d2793:1

value
1010573
script pubkey
OP_0 OP_PUSHBYTES_20 7e1f6ff4fe861098a37de7e6414736c9e78b6531
address
bc1q0c0kla87scgf3gmaulnyz3eke8nckef32n937g
transaction
bf64aa51d56632183fc4c495a5b418856469a0eb373332e720d3ef2ec74d2793
confirmations
40861
spent
true